Queue (2) 썸네일형 리스트형 (C++) - 프로그래머스(고득점 kit - 스택/큐) : 프린터 답 programmers.co.kr/learn/courses/30/lessons/42587 코딩테스트 연습 - 프린터 일반적인 프린터는 인쇄 요청이 들어온 순서대로 인쇄합니다. 그렇기 때문에 중요한 문서가 나중에 인쇄될 수 있습니다. 이런 문제를 보완하기 위해 중요도가 높은 문서를 먼저 인쇄하는 프린 programmers.co.kr 우선순위 큐와 큐를 사용해 푼 문제였습니다. 풀이방법 1. 우선순위 큐와 큐에 우선순위 정보를 push합니다. 2. 우선순위가 같다면 프린트 하고, 문서번호까지 같으면 정답입니다. Code #include using namespace std; int solution(vector priorities, int location) { int answer = 0, cnt = 0; queu.. (C++) - 백준(BOJ) 10845번 : 큐(queue) https://www.acmicpc.net/problem/10845 10845번: 큐 첫째 줄에 주어지는 명령의 수 N (1 ≤ N ≤ 10,000)이 주어진다. 둘째 줄부터 N개의 줄에는 명령이 하나씩 주어진다. 주어지는 정수는 1보다 크거나 같고, 100,000보다 작거나 같다. 문제에 나와있지 www.acmicpc.net 자료구조 queue를 사용하는 문제였습니다. Code #include using namespace std; int n; queue q; int main(){ cin >> n; while(n--){ string op; cin >> op; if(op == "push"){ int x; cin >> x; q.push(x); } else if(op == "pop"){ if(q.size()).. 이전 1 다음